What is the difference between Kitchen Manager Assistant Manager vs Kitchen Supervisor?

AspectKitchen ManagerAssistant ManagerKitchen Supervisor
CredentialsFood safety certifications, management experienceFood safety certifications, supervisory experienceFood safety certifications, some supervisory experience
Work EnvironmentOversees entire kitchen operationsSupports kitchen manager, handles daily tasksSupervises kitchen staff, ensures quality
Employer UsageRestaurants, hotels, cateringRestaurants, hotels, cateringRestaurants, catering, institutional kitchens

The main difference is that the Kitchen Manager oversees all kitchen operations and strategic planning, while the Assistant Manager supports the Kitchen Manager and handles daily tasks. The Kitchen Supervisor focuses on supervising staff and maintaining quality standards. Both roles require food safety certifications, but the Kitchen Manager typically has more managerial experience and responsibilities.

What is a kitchen manager assistant manager?

Kitchen Manager Assistant Managers are professionals who support the kitchen manager in overseeing the daily operations of a restaurant or food service kitchen. Their responsibilities typically include supervising kitchen staff, ensuring food safety and quality standards are met, managing inventory and supplies, and assisting with scheduling and training. They play a key role in maintaining efficient kitchen operations and helping deliver a positive dining experience for customers. In many establishments, they also step in to handle managerial duties when the kitchen manager is unavailable.

Job description

Job Summary:

Kitchen Managers need to be able to handle operations with passion, integrity, and knowledge all while embodying and promoting Love, Energy and Food. Must be able to work alongside a diverse team. Has ability to work in and handle a fast-paced environment. The expectation of the Kitchen Manager is to work alongside all Team Members during peak hours as well as provide support, direction, and best practices in all aspects of kitchen operations. This position reports directly to the Assistant Executive Kitchen Manager and assists in all aspects of Assistant Executive Kitchen Manager duties and responsibilities.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ities (included but not limited to):
  • Verify and correct where necessary, that all products are stored and prepared based on the Craft Food Hall standards.
  • Check and maintain hot and cold storage temperature control points.
  • Supervise kitchen team members are following all food and safety standards.
  • Maintaining a positive work environment for your team members.
  • Train team members on menu builds and standards.
  • Comfortability with corrective action and corrective training where necessary.
  • Verifying team members are maintaining sanitation levels.
  • Partner with the Assistant Executive Kitchen Manager and ensure an open line of communication.
